How would you spend your 92nd birthday? Would you record a heavy metal album? Well, thats what Christopher Lee did. This year, hes created an album of covers of various songs in a heavy metal style as a tribute to Miguel de Cervantes novel Don Quixote. Its called Metal Knight.
